Reggie Bush's standout performance cements legacy in USC history
Summary

Reggie Bush's legendary status at USC was highlighted during a key game against Fresno State on November 19, 2005. In a high-scoring clash, Bush gained 364 yards from scrimmage and scored two touchdowns, showcasing his exceptional talent. This game not only contributed to USC's victory but also played a pivotal role in Bush clinching the Heisman Trophy. His performance has drawn comparisons to historic moments in college football, solidifying his place in the sport's history.
